웹‘Bargadar’ or ‘bhagchasi’ is a Bengali word, which means a person who cultivates the land of another person and takes a portion of the crop. The bargadars occupy a special position in …

웹2024년 4월 24일 · Tebagha means 1/3rd of agricultural produce (crop). This movement was against the traditional sharecropping system. ...
